Description

Nice old time example from the Schwaz-Brixlegg area: silvery grey schwazite (mercurian tetrahedrite) is accompanied/covered by in part blueish aragonite (could also be Emmonite, not tested), an olive green secondary mineral which was not formally identified and what i think is malachite (could be some other green copper secondary though).
